anybody have any problems with the 40 min connection flying Air Jamaica from Bonaire to Atlanta - arrive Montego Bay 5:10, leave 5:50PM>?

We traveled AJ in July and had the short connection time on return to Atlanta. We were delayed on Bonaire because incoming flight was late. We did make the flight to Atlanta, but they were loading when we arrived. Only able to make a quick visit to restroom. I would suggest you purchase any gifts earlier.
